# Scaling constants for the PanMath recipe calculator.
#
# Scaling is not purely linear: leavening and seasoning use damped
# exponents, and yields are rounded to practical kitchen measures.
# Do not "simplify" the exponents to 1.0 — the Bakewell test suite
# encodes tasted-and-approved outputs and will fail. Rounding
# granularity differs for dry and liquid units on purpose. If you
# change anything here, rerun the golden-recipe fixtures. The
# constants in use are as follows.

tuning constants:
QUOTAS = {
    "druwyn": 5,
    "holix": 5,
    "zorath": 5,
    "holwyn": 10,
}

Onboarding note — Canteen arrangements, Ashgrove Works

The ground-floor canteen is shared with our neighbours at Fennel & Vane under a reciprocal arrangement. Their staff may enter via the garden-side door between 11:30 and 14:00 on weekdays only. Facilities desk staff should check that visiting diners display a valid Fennel & Vane badge. The garden-side door operates on a keypad, and the current code is:

door code, yagap-bahof: bdg-O-05

# Build Provenance: Session-Token Refresh Fix

Plugin authors: the Ferngate host runtime patched a session-token refresh bug where tokens expired mid-request and plugins received opaque auth failures. Fixed builds refresh tokens proactively with a 60-second margin. Do not work around this in plugin code; remove any retry shims targeting the old behavior. Verify your host is on a fixed build before filing reports. Unfixed hosts will reject the new handshake header. The minimum fixed build token is listed directly below.

trace token, kahog-tajeg: htk6_97d963